What is the leading coefficient in the quadratic below?
h(x)=-2x2+5x+10

Answer:

-2

Step-by-step explanation:

The leading coefficient in a polynomial is the coefficient that corresponds with the highest degree term. In this case, -2 is the leading coefficient since its term has x² as the highest degree of the quadratic.
